Job DetailsJob Location: NEA Dental - Dunwoody, GA 30338Position Type: Full TimeTitle of Position: Customer Success Advisor (CSA) – Dental RCM Organizational Relationship: Reports to President, Tech-Enabled Managed Services Job Family: Operations Managerial Responsibilities: Direct/Indirect Classification: Exempt / Full-Time #LI-Remote GENERAL SUMMARY: The Customer Success Advisor (CSA) is the primary operational leader for a portfolio of clients within a pod. This role combines deep Dental RCM expertise with client leadership and team direction to ensure consistent execution and strong results. This is an operations-first role with direct accountability for RCM performance, not a traditional relationship-only customer success position. The CSA acts as the bridge between clients, offshore delivery teams, and pod leadership—owning day-to-day performance, managing priorities, and resolving issues. This role is similar to a Billing Manager or front-line RCM leader within a DSO, operating in a tech-enabled managed services environment. D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ES: Client Ownership & Relationship Management Serve as the primary point of contact for assigned clients Own client-level RCM performance and outcomes Translate client goals and issues into clear operational priorities Lead regular performance reviews using data-driven insights RCM Execution & Subject-Matter Expertise Act as an RCM expert across claims, follow-up, denials, and payments Diagnose payer, workflow, and data-related issues Recommend corrective actions and ensure execution Confidently manage and resolve client escalations Offshore Team Leadership Direct, prioritize, and coordinate work for offshore associates Ensure work queues align with client priorities and SLAs Enforce quality standards and adherence to defined processes Provide feedback and escalate performance concerns when necessary Data & Performance Management Monitor daily and weekly KPIs to identify risks and trends Use data to proactively drive improvements Partner with the Pod Leader on operational changes and initiatives Ensure accurate reporting and documentation Player/Coach Expectations Willing and able to step into RCM process execution when required Coach offshore teams through complex scenarios Support peer CSAs during peak workload or escalations What Success Looks Like Clients trust the CSA and see consistent, measurable results Offshore teams execute with clarity, quality, and accountability Escalations are resolved quickly and professionally Performance issues are identified early and corrected Clients renew and expand relationships with Vyne PHYSICAL DEMAND: The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this job. Role Description The Pod Leader owns the operating and financial performance of a geographic pod serving up to ~250 dental clients. This role functions as a mini–general manager with full accountability for results, responsible for building scalable, repeatable operations while delivering strong client outcomes. The Pod Leader is expected to be hands-on early, setting the foundation for future pods by defining processes, operating rhythms, and performance standards. This role partners closely with the Division President and cross-functional teams to scale the Vyne managed services model. As the first Vyne Pod leader, this person will be instrumental in establishing the playbook for all future Pods and, as such, will rely heavily on a “builder’s mindset” and approach. An entrepreneurial spirit and passion will be key. Duties & Responsibilities - Pod Ownership & Financial Performance - Own full pod-level P&L, including revenue, cost structure, margin, and growth targets - Drive client outcomes across the full Dental RCM lifecycle (claims submission, follow-up, denials, payment posting, and AR management) - Monitor and optimize key performance metrics including DSO, net collections, aging, productivity, and SLA adherence - Operational Design & Scalability - Build, document, and continuously refine the operational playbook for pod execution - Standardize workflows, escalation paths, QA processes, and performance management routines - Partner with Product and Technology teams to operationalize tech-enabled workflows - Identify operational bottlenecks and lead continuous improvement initiatives - Leadership & Team Management - Lead, coach, and develop Customer Success Advisors (CSAs) - Provide direction, prioritization, and accountability across offshore delivery teams (indirectly via partner) - Establish clear performance expectations and foster a high-ownership culture - Operate as a player/coach, stepping into complex client or operational issues as needed - Client & Stakeholder Engagement - Serve as the executive escalation point for pod clients - Build trusted relationships with larger or more complex customers - Partner closely with the Division President on pod strategy, scaling, and expansion - Represent operational insights and client feedback in cross-functional discussions What Success Looks Like - Pod meets or exceeds financial and operating targets - Clients experience measurable improvement in RCM performance - Offshore teams operate predictably with minimal escalations - Processes are well-documented, repeatable, and transferable to new pods - CSAs are developed and promoted as the pod scales Physical Demand The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this job.
